    #Farnesina: Italy’s culinary arts arrive in space

    Italy’s culinary arts arrive in space, thanks to Argotec. The company’s young engineers, working with Italian chefs and astronauts, have created a “Space Food Lab” in collaboration with the European Space Agency (ESA) and its Italian counterpart (ASI).     Dei/Sole 24 Ore – Poland: Ferrero to expand its Belsk production facility

    Ferrero Polska, part of the Ferrero Group, has decided to expand its production facility in Belsk, about 60km from Warsaw. Ferrero opened the factory in 1997, initially to produce Nutella, Kinder eggs, Kinder Bueno and Raffaello.     Barcelona – Italy’s Oscar-winning films in Spain

    The first Italian film-maker to win an Oscar was Vittorio De Sica, with “Sciuscià” – a neorealism masterpiece from 1947. And in March 2014 Paolo Sorrentino’s “La Grande bellezza” brought the total of Italian Oscar-winning films to 13.     Los Angeles – Challenging convention at Juxtapoz Italiano

    The exhibition entitled “Juxtapoz Italiano – Four Artists who Defy Convention” has opened in Los Angeles and will run until 1 October 2014. The exhibition brings together the work of Nicola Verlato, Fulvio di Piazza, Marco Mazzoni and Agostino Arrivabene, four painters who interpret and innovate the figurative tradition in Italian art.
